Nature & Culture Capability Progression Points
Biological & Earth Sciences
Year 10
Year 9
Year 8
Year 7
Year 6
Students analyse how biological systems function and respond to external changes with reference to the interdependencies between individual components, energy transfers and flows of matter. They describe and analyse interactions and cycles within and between Earth’s spheres.
Students understand how biological systems function and respond to external changes. They identify and interpret interactions and cycles within and between Earth’s spheres.
Students identify and classify living things. They predict the effect of environmental changes on feeding relationships between organisms in a food web. They compare processes of rock formation and analyse how the sustainable use of resources depends on the way they are formed and cycle through Earth systems.
Students analyse the effect of environmental changes on individual living things. They identify rock formation and understand how the sustainable use of resources depends on the way they are formed and cycle through Earth systems.
Students analyse how structural and behavioural adaptations of living things enhance their survival, and predict and describe the effect of environmental changes on individual living things.
